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54861 266 66773 364078834
57942 62 926133556
57942 62 926133556
5349 733378 1261755097
All about undefined
Interested in learning more?
57942 62 926133556
5349 733378 1261755097
See more
69212948940 59186170612 6587
81316 27152225 4144 90 185
See more
512438445 64868
10415543081 124 3970 5484088 236
See more